Pre-Open Movers 12/05: Adolor (ADLR) Higher on Pfizer Deal, Comcast (CMCSA) Sinks On Guidance

December 5, 2007 9:27 AM EST
StreetInsider.com Pre-Open Movers:

TOP Tankers Inc (Nasdaq: TOPT) 21% LOWER; prices 21,000,000 share offering.

Collective Brands Inc. (NYSE: PSS) 16% HIGHER; reported Q3 EPS of $0.39, above the analyst estimate of $0.32. Revenues for the quarter were $830.7 million, versus the consensus of $848.22 million.

Adolor Corporation (Nasdaq: ADLR) 13% HIGHER; Pfizer Inc (NYSE: PFE) and Adolor Corporation announced an exclusive worldwide collaboration to develop and commercialize novel compounds, ADL5859 and ADL5747, for the treatment of pain.

Photronics (Nasdaq: PLAB) 10% LOWER; reported Q3 EPS of $0.01, in-line with the analyst estimate of $0.01. Revenues for the quarter were $101.6 million, versus the consensus of $104.72 million.

Chico's FAS, Inc. (NYSE: CHS) 10% LOWER; reported Q3 EPS of $0.10, ex-items, 1 cents lower than the analyst estimate of $0.11. Revenues for the quarter were $416 million, versus the consensus of $420.98 million.

Sohu.com Inc. (Nasdaq: SOHU) 8% HIGHER; raises Q4 guidance. Sohu.com sees Q4 revenues of $55.5-$57.5 million. The consensus is $53.8 million. Sees Q4 Non-GAAP EPS of $0.36-$0.38. The consensus is $0.29

Synta Pharmaceuticals Corp. (NASDAQ: SNTA) 7.5% HIGHER; received an upfront non-refundable cash payment of $80 million from GlaxoSmithKline (NYSE: GSK) following expiration of the waiting period imposed by the FTC under the Hart Scott Rodino Antitrust Improvements Act for their collaboration agreement for the joint development and commercialization of elesclomol entered into on October 8, 2007.

Comcast Corporation (Nasdaq: CMCSA) (Nasdaq: CMCSK) 7% LOWER; Reflecting an increasingly challenging economic and competitive environment and consistent with trends across the sector, Revenue Generating Units are now expected to increase by approximately 6 million to 57 million, versus previous guidance of approximately 6.5 million additions.

Western Digital (NYSE: WDC) 7% HIGHER; sees December quarter revenues in the range of $2.025 billion to $2.075 billion with earnings per share in the range of $1.02 to $1.06. The consensus is $1.9 billion and $0.77. Western Digital sees gross margin at or above the high-end of its long-term model range of 15 to 20 percent. On December 5, 2007, Western Digital will purchase all $250,000,000 in face value of the outstanding 2.125% Convertible Subordinated Notes due 2014.

Guess (NYSE: GES) 5.8% HIGHER; reported Q3 EPS of $0.62, 4 cents better than the analyst estimate of $0.58. Revenues for the quarter were $469.1 million, versus the consensus of $424.46 million. Sees FY08 EPS of $1.93-$1.96, versus the consensus of $1.92. Sees FY09 EPS of $2.35-$2.45, versus the consensus of $2.29.

Solarfun Power Holdings Co. Ltd. (Nasdaq: SOLF) 5.7% HIGHER; Continues recent upside surge

Research In Motion (Nasdaq: RIMM) 4% HIGHER; TD Newcrest upgrades RIM from Hold to Buy with a $130 price target, citing solid business and lower valuation.

Novell, Inc. (Nasdaq: NOVL) 3.4% LOWER; will postpone its fourth quarter and full-year 2007 earnings release and conference call that were scheduled for today, Wednesday, Dec. 5, 2007.

D&B (NYSE: DNB) 3% HIGHER; increased its guidance for core revenue growth to 8 percent to 10 percent, versus prior guidance of 7 percent to 9 percent growth. The Company reaffirmed its guidance for operating income growth of 8 percent to 10 percent. The Company also reaffirmed its guidance for diluted EPS growth of 11 percent to 14 percent. D&B also announced that its Board of Directors has authorized a new two-year, $400 million share repurchase program. D&B also announced that it has acquired AllBusiness.com, Inc. for approximately $55 million.

Ford Motor Co. (NYSE: F) 2% HIGHER; Calyon upgrades to Add
